Navigating the Complexities of a Mobile-First Ecosystem
Developing a true strategic asset involves navigating a landscape fraught with technical complexities. The sheer diversity of the mobile ecosystem presents one of the most significant hurdles. Developers must contend with a vast and ever-growing fragmentation of devices, screen sizes, and operating system versions across both iOS and Android platforms. An application that performs perfectly on a high-end flagship device may fail to function correctly on a budget model, making comprehensive testing and adaptive design non-negotiable requirements for success.
Beyond device compatibility, performance optimization under variable conditions is a critical challenge. Mobile users interact with applications in a multitude of environments, from stable Wi-Fi networks to areas with spotty cellular coverage. A strategic application must be engineered to handle these fluctuations gracefully, managing data synchronization, offline capabilities, and resource consumption efficiently. This requires a deep understanding of platform-specific limitations, such as background processing rules and power management protocols, to ensure the application remains responsive and reliable no matter the circumstance. The architectural challenge, therefore, is to build a system that is both powerful and resilient.
The Governance Gauntlet Compliance Security and Data Privacy Mandates
In an environment where mobile applications frequently handle sensitive personal and corporate data, the regulatory and security landscape has become a primary consideration in development. Adherence to platform-specific policies from Apple and Google is merely the starting point. These guidelines, which govern everything from data handling to in-app purchases, are continuously updated and require diligent monitoring to ensure an application remains compliant and available on the app stores. Failure to comply can result in removal from these critical distribution channels, effectively cutting off an application from its user base.
Beyond platform rules, robust data governance protocols are essential for building trust and mitigating risk. This involves implementing stringent security measures as a core component of the application’s architecture, not as an afterthought. Practices such as end-to-end encryption for data in transit and at rest, secure authentication mechanisms, and strict access controls are fundamental. A strategic approach to development embeds these security principles from the project’s inception, ensuring that the application is designed to protect sensitive information and align with global data privacy regulations like GDPR, thereby safeguarding both the user and the organization.
Engineering for Tomorrow The Future of Strategic Mobile Applications
The future of mobile applications lies in their ability to evolve. A strategic asset is not a static product that is launched and forgotten; it is a living system that requires long-term lifecycle management. This forward-looking approach begins during the initial architectural design, where decisions are made to support future scalability and maintainability. By creating comprehensive documentation and adopting modular design principles, organizations ensure that the application can be updated and enhanced over time without incurring prohibitive technical debt or depending on the ad-hoc knowledge of the original development team.
Data analytics plays a pivotal role in guiding this evolution. By integrating analytics frameworks to capture anonymized user interaction data, organizations can gain actionable insights into how the application is being used in the real world. This feedback loop informs future development priorities, allowing teams to refine the user experience, optimize popular features, and strategically plan for new functionalities based on observed behavior rather than assumptions. This data-driven approach ensures that the application remains relevant, valuable, and closely aligned with the shifting needs of its users, cementing its status as a dynamic and enduring asset.
